[QUOTE="velis, post: 488324, member: 96429"] Hm, I've made the planned modifications on my HTPC, but I got into a bit of trouble: First, I had to manually install the avivo package and then manually register the filter dlls (the installer package didn't try to register them as an admin) Now I can't seem to make the Avivo codec play H264 content. I've set all the merits, etc. It plays DivX / XVid just fine (some 5-8% CPU utilization). Though ffdshow uses about the same CPU for the same video. However, H264 doesn't work at all. I tried to set the filter manually in graphedit, but when I try to make a connection, it says: These filters cannot agree on a connection. Verify type compatibility of input pin and output pin. No combination of intermediate filters could be found to make the connection (Return code: 0x80040217) Also CCC doesn't show the avivo transcoder in the tree. I also downloaded Cyberlink's trial: [url]http://www.cyberlink.com/cinema/ati/h264_decoder/enu/index.jsp[/url] But this one can't seem to find a suitable output renderer. Tried CoreAVC too, but it's worse than ffdshow. Please help. [/QUOTE]
